8/10
Nasty Undercurrents
Hitchcoc15 February 2022
Warning: Spoilers
There's a lot to process here. The obviously conniving Turner hops into bed with Russell. He rejects her but the die is cast for the future. There is an uncomfortable scene at the secretary's family's house through some really bad judgment and preconceptions. A little dog gets lost and this leads to a degree of pomposity (You'll have to watch). There are efforts to get the Russells to pull some punches. Mr. Rake continues his efforts at courtship. And the much maligned Mrs. Chamberlain is becomes a more significant figure.

7/10
Marian's Boots lol
jpismyname11 October 2023
Warning: Spoilers
New York Globe editor T. Thomas Fortune, who is a real historical figure as well, takes an interest in Peggy's story and decides to publish it. Marian secretly befriends the mysterious Mrs. Chamberlain. Mrs. Fanes, afraid to end up like the Morris family, decides to help Bertha. Another shocking scene involves the cunning lady's maid Turner getting naked.

Honestly I would've rated this episode a little higher if not for Marian's storylines. I don't know if it's the writing or her acting, but her character sometimes feels so forced. And what's up with her bringing those old shoes?? It felt like an unnatural thing to do and it felt so random lmao.
